Actualmente DIM-EDU es una red social educativa que conecta más de 27.000 agentes educativos de todo el mundo; de ellos, 15.000 son participantes activos en algunas de sus actividades y 5.500 están inscritos en la red.
Su objetivo es promover la innovación educativa orientada a la mejora de la calidad y la eficacia de la formación que ofrecen los centros docentes, y así contribuir al desarrollo integral de los estudiantes y al bienestar de las personas y la mejora de la sociedad. Ver más...
